Paris, September 1908
Season 2 - Episode 13
 
 
Paris, September 1908
Professor Indiana Jones attends the auction of a Degas painting 'The Woman at her Toilet' which he claims to mean the world to him. He explains how he got involved in a quarrel between Degas and young Pablo Picasso in Paris, 1908. While there, Indy befriended a young American boy named Norman Rockwell and together they learned to appreciate the nuances of modern art.
